Output e0de586461d9c468b933c43b46bff4599f36a3dd61f7ce07627cffdecaf4a11e:139

value
76866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ff69855fdb893c5f7fd9d7fd9124729611cb8224 OP_EQUAL
address
3QyWeBqgcSBM8J7eo7gJUfknU77aQff39g
transaction
e0de586461d9c468b933c43b46bff4599f36a3dd61f7ce07627cffdecaf4a11e
confirmations
170116
spent
true